Recently, Japanese scientists successfully isolated four plant photosynthetic genes. The four plants are: rice, pear, pine and corn. It is the first time in the world to isolate the photosynthetic genes of the first three plants. It has been found that different plants have different photosynthetic abilities and photosynthetic rates. Photosynthesis of major tropical crops (such as corn and sugar cane) is stronger than the main temperate crops (such as rice, wheat and soybeans) and the photosynthetic rate is also fast.
